OpenGIS-XLS

OpenGIS is a Location (Web) Services(s) that are built on the open standards of the Open Geospatial Consortium, Inc. (OGC), in conformity to the OpenGIS® Location Service (OpenLS) Implementation Specification: Core Services (OLS Core) v1.1.1.  These are defined as application schemas that are encoded in XML for Location Services XLS.

OpenGIS-XLS is capable of receiving and returning responses in the specified XLS format.  LISAsoft’s implementation takes the incoming request (XML) and selects the appropriate service to handle the request, and composes the (XML) response to XLS format.

This has many advantages, including use of a precise specification, inter-operable with other services, such as WMS, WFS, and GML data structures, but not bound to Java or Byte Code.
